Description

The CamelBak Arête 18 is one of our most versatile backpacks. It’s a double- duty backpack that quickly reverses into an insulated reservoir sleeve that fits inside larger hiking backpacks. When you flip it right side out, you’ll have plenty of room for layers, snacks, essentials, and 1.5-liters of fresh water. Water is supplied by a durable Crux reservoir that is simple to load and easy to refill. The Crux design produces 20% more water per sip. It also includes an ergonomic handle and an easy to use on/off switch. We designed the CamelBak Arête 18 to be both sturdy and lightweight. This hiking backpack is made from ultralight and compressible materials. It is also equipped with user-friendly features including an adjustable sternum strap for a comfortable fit. Our Got Your Bak Lifetime Guarantee covers all reservoirs, backpacks, bottles and accessories from manufacturing defects in materials and workmanship for the lifetime of the product.

  • Great for day trips
I purchased this before a 10 day trip to some national parks. I used this on short 3-4 hour hikes and it is the perfect size. The 2L bladder was easy to use/refill. The bag is incredibly light weight and comfortable. You can easily fit a first aid kit, a light jacket, some snacks, and another water bottle in the bag. The material is easy to clean and didn't tear. The price tag was a little higher than I wanted but it suits my needs perfectly! ... show more

  • Light weight, perfect for small day hikes and trips
I bought this for light day hikes in the Adirondacks. The water reservoir was perfect for an easy 6 mile trek. The pack itself is very light and was comfortable to wear when packed with snacks, extra layers and day hike necessities. I did one longer hike and packed an extra 1.5L Nalgene in it. Because there are no internal pockets or dividers, my extra water weighed the pack down and made it uncomfortable. The side zipper fits an inhaler, chapstick, iPhone X and headphones. Very handy! ... show more
